Admission Criteria

General Student: Students having a combined GPA of 5.0 in S.S.C and H.S.C with a minimum of 2.5 in each or a total GPA of 6.00* with a minimum GPA of 2.00 either in S.S.C or in H.S.C. or any equivalent background with a minimum “C” grade in English from any group may apply for admission.

English Medium Student: Students completing five O-level subjects and at least two A-level subjects may apply. Out of these 7 subjects, applicants must have a minimum 4 “B” grade and 3 “C” grade.
